GENERAL RECOMMENDATIONS

The warranty on this tractor does not cover items that have been subjected to operator abuse or negligence. To receive full value from the warranty, operator must maintain tractor as instructed in this manual

Some adjustments will need to be made periodically to properly maintain your tractor.

All adjustments in the Service and Adjustments section of this manual should be checked at least once each season.

"Once a year you should replace the spark plug, clean

or replace air filter, and check blades and belts for wear. A new spark plug and clean air filter assure proper air4uel mixture and help your engine run better and last Ionger_

BEFORE EACH USE

Check engine oil level o Check brake operation°

o Check tire pressure.,

o Check for loose fasteners,
